Tips for Optimizing Your Sentra's Audio

To get the most out of your Sentra's audio system, here are some optimization tips. First, adjust the equalizer settings to match your preferences. Most head units allow you to customize the bass, treble, and mid-range frequencies. Experiment with different settings to find the sound that you enjoy most. Speaker placement can also affect the sound quality. Make sure that the speakers are not obstructed by anything, such as cargo or seat covers. You can also try adjusting the speaker balance and fader settings to optimize the soundstage. If you have a premium audio system with a subwoofer, adjust the subwoofer level to your liking. Too much bass can sound muddy, while too little bass can make the sound feel thin. Consider upgrading your speakers for better sound quality. Aftermarket speakers can often provide a significant improvement over the factory speakers. Look for speakers that are designed to handle the power output of your head unit or amplifier. Sound deadening materials can help to reduce road noise and vibrations, which can improve the overall listening experience. Applying sound deadening to the doors, floor, and trunk can make a noticeable difference. If you're using Bluetooth to stream music, make sure that your device is set to the highest quality audio setting. Some devices may default to a lower quality setting to save battery life. Keep your music files organized and properly tagged. This will make it easier to find and play your favorite songs. Finally, clean your speakers regularly to remove dust and debris. This can help to maintain the sound quality over time. By following these tips, you can optimize your Sentra's audio system and enjoy a more immersive and enjoyable listening experience.
